Location Information

The property is located on Berry Head Road, nearby the South Western Coastal Path that offers great local walks to stretch your legs. Less than a mile away along this path is the Guardhouse Café, providing a great spot for a cup of tea and a bite to eat while enjoying the stunning cliffside views and the Napoleonic fortifications.

The Breakwater Beach, Brixham’s stunning shingle beach, is close by and has a Blue Flag Award — a global standard that commends cleanliness, safety, and environmental considerations.

Popular local eateries such as The Prince William and Rockfish are situated on the Marina, and a short stroll from here brings you to the town centre with its eclectic local business & access to the wider beyond by bus or seasonal ferry, including Dartmouth, Paignton and Torquay.
